Output 6335af4a73eccbb6c1059b5b5c54b6802415f5c746cf87c311f9b8cb3d0b232a: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3a0ab2901124ce2b24251fa54dce951b1829e40 OP_EQUAL
address
3NSbnYD96E8Ft4XALK5vESRvRn3tWbo2k5
transaction
6335af4a73eccbb6c1059b5b5c54b6802415f5c746cf87c311f9b8cb3d0b232a
spent
true